After it was leaked a few months ago in MyPhone’s website, their first
LTE-capable Android smartphone is now available thru Lazada.
It comes only in black and priced lower than it was at it’s previous leak at P5,499. It is now the country’s most affordable LTE Android phone.

MyPhone Rio LTE has a 1.3 Ghz Mediatek MT6582 quad-core (probably with an LTE modem inside), has 4.5 inch FWVGA display, 5 MP rear camera with flash and 1,700 maH battery.
No information yet if when it will be available in MyPhone branches and kiosks.
